pivot4j icon indicating copy to clipboard operation
pivot4j copied to clipboard

Provide REST API for core features

Open mysticfall opened this issue 9 years ago • 11 comments

We need to implement REST API service layer to allow integration with non-JSF clients, like AngularJS.

  • https://groups.google.com/forum/#!topic/pivot4j-list/FzqIT4fs4Jc

mysticfall avatar Sep 14 '14 04:09 mysticfall

Starting the work on the scala branch.

mysticfall avatar Sep 14 '14 08:09 mysticfall

Hi Mysticfall,

I want to create a client with AngularJS, and like to know if the API is stable? and any reason to choose Spring instead JAX-RS?

Best regards

cwichoski avatar May 16 '15 17:05 cwichoski

I'm sorry to say but the work on this issue has been suspended for sometime, due to my changing the priorities with other projects.

Last time it was updated, I managed to finish some part of repository API with unit tests. Technically, it wouldn't be too difficult to finish up the remaining part, but I don't think I'll find enough time to revisit this issue anytime soon.

There wasn't any specific reason why I chose Spring WS over JAX-RS rather than I felt slightly more comfortable with the former technology.

Anyway, sorry I couldn't help you much any longer. I suppose it's good time I should look for another maintainer, if there's still enough interest for this project.

Cheers, Xavier

mysticfall avatar May 19 '15 13:05 mysticfall

Hi Xavier,

Thanks for your reply, its for entire pivot4j, or just for the API part?

best regards Clóvis

cwichoski avatar May 19 '15 16:05 cwichoski

It's for the project, unfortunately, as I've gave up BI / Java programming about an year ago to work in another domain using Scala/Scala.js.

mysticfall avatar May 19 '15 17:05 mysticfall

as I need this stuff for a java project, I can go ahead from your work, if you authorize.

cwichoski avatar May 19 '15 17:05 cwichoski

I'd be very grateful if you can do that. Please let me know if you need anything. Thanks! :)

mysticfall avatar May 19 '15 23:05 mysticfall

Ok I will start analysing your code to become familiar with the architecture and the approachs you used, and if have any doubt I ask you for help. Thanks! ;)

cwichoski avatar May 22 '15 00:05 cwichoski

@cwichoski Are you thinking about going forward with this? We would love to integrate an angular.js version of pivot4j-analytics into our application, but also publish an API to allow other developers direct access to our OLAP cubes via pivot4j.

designet avatar Jun 20 '15 13:06 designet

I'm also interested in an Angular front end for pivot4j, and ready to contribute if necessary. What is the status of this initiative?

ps3331333 avatar Jun 29 '16 18:06 ps3331333

@ps3331333 I'm sorry to say that this project has been abandoned for quite a while. I'm still trying to fix issues and answer questions occasionally, but I'm afraid I won't be able to do any new work on the project anytime soon.

However, please feel free to ask for support if you are willing to contribute on this issue. I'll try my best to help.

Thanks!

mysticfall avatar Jul 03 '16 12:07 mysticfall